1.First you need to show hidden files.
Open Folder Options in Control Panel.
Click Start, and then click Control Panel.
Click Appearance and Themes, and then click Folder Options.
2.On the View tab, under Hidden files and folders, click Show hidden files and folders.
Now you will see the dlog.dat file.
If is a 0KB,that means is empty.So you are clean at the moment.
